Discover the Eastern Red Bud Trees

Set 2 Eastern Red Bud Trees Live in Quart Pot is the perfect addition to your garden. These beautiful trees, known for their striking pink flowers, make a stunning statement in any landscape. The Eastern Redbud, or Cercis canadensis, is a small tree or large deciduous shrub that can reach heights of 7 to 10 feet in just 5 to 6 years.

These trees thrive in USDA Hardiness Zones 4 to 9, making them suitable for a wide range of climates. They require full sun for optimal flowering, adding vibrant colors to your garden throughout the blooming season. These live redbud trees are ideal for planting in spacious areas where they can fully display their beauty.

Benefits of Eastern Red Bud Trees:

  • Stunning pink spring flowers that attract pollinators.
  • Beautiful heart-shaped leaves that offer seasonal interest.
  • Perfect for creating shade and enhancing privacy.
  • Low maintenance and adaptable to various soil types.
  • Great for landscaping and as a focal point in gardens.

Whether you are a seasoned gardener or a beginner, these Eastern Red Bud Trees are easy to care for. Ensure they are planted in well-drained soil and receive adequate sunlight. With proper care, they will flourish and provide beauty for years to come.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the ideal soil type for Eastern Red Bud Trees? They thrive in well-drained, loamy soil.
  • How tall do Eastern Red Bud Trees grow? They can reach heights of 7 to 10 feet in 5 to 6 years.
  • When is the best time to plant these trees? Spring or fall is the ideal planting season.
  • Do they require full sun? Yes, they flower best in full sunlight.
  • Are Eastern Red Bud Trees suitable for small gardens? Yes, they are perfect for small spaces due to their moderate size.
